Key EA Titles - Fiscal Year 2011 * Q1 FY2011 - April 1 through June 30, 2010 o Skate 3 (Console) o Green Day: Rock Band [Distribution] (Console) o APB / All Points Bulletin [Distribution] (PC) o 2010 FIFA World Cup South Africa (Console, Handheld/Mobile) o Tiger Woods PGA TOUR Online (PC) o Tiger Woods PGA TOUR 11 (Console, Handheld/Mobile) * Q2 FY2011 - July 1 through September 30, 2010 o Need for Speed World (PC) o NCAA Football 11 (Console) o EA SPORTS FIFA Online (PC) o Madden NFL 11 (Console, Handheld/Mobile) o FIFA 11 (Console, Handheld/Mobile, PC) o NHL 11 (Console) o MySims SkyHeroes (Console, Handheld/Mobile) * Q3 FY 2011- October 1 through December 31, 2010 o Medal of Honor (Console, Handheld/Mobile, PC) o Crysis 2 [Co-Published] (Console, PC) o Need For Speed Title TBA (Console, Handheld/Mobile, PC) o EA Partners Game TBA [Distribution] (Console, Handheld/Mobile) o EA SPORTS MMA (Console, Handheld) o FIFA Manager 11 (PC) o NBA Jam (Console) o NBA Live 11 (Console, Handheld/Mobile) o EA SPORTS Active Title TBA (Console) o EA SPORTS Active 2.0 (Console, Handheld/Mobile) o FAMILY GAME NIGHT 3 (Console) o LITTLEST PET SHOP 3 Biggest Stars (Handheld/Mobile) o MONOPOLY Streets (Console, Handheld/Mobile) o Harry Potter TBA (Console, Handheld, PC) o EA Play Game TBA (Console, PC) o The Sims 3 (Console, Handheld/Mobile) * Q4 FY 2011- January 1 through March 31, 2011 o Dead Space 2 (Console, Handheld/Mobile, PC) o Dragon Age Title TBA (Console, Handheld/Mobile, PC) o Bulletstorm [Co-Published] (Console, PC) o Need For Speed TBA (Console, PC) o EA SPORTS Fighting Title TBA (Console, Handheld/Mobile) o New Sims Title TBA (PC) o Spore Title TBA (PC)
